位于北山中带的月牙山-洗肠井蛇绿岩带是北山地区出露最好的蛇绿岩带之一,枕状玄武岩和堆晶辉长岩表现出轻稀土元素亏损-平坦的分配模式,(La/Yb)N=0.47~1.62,类似N-MORB;而相对于N-MORB则又富集大离子亲石元素,亏损Nb、Ta等高场强元素,与典型岛弧火山岩相似;即基性岩类同时具有类似岛弧火山岩和洋中脊火山岩的地球化学特征,与产出于弧后盆地的新疆库尔提蛇绿岩的基性岩及现代弧后盆地(Mariana)相似,根据其地球化学特征进行构造环境判别,基本反映出弧后盆地火山岩的特征.另外样品的ENd(t)为较高的正值(6.11~8.17),表明其源区应为亏损地幔.结合研究区的沉积建造特征可以判断,月牙山-洗肠井蛇绿岩应形成于弧后盆地,与其北部的斜山-东七一山火山弧构成塔里木板块北缘的“弧-盆”体系.%The YueyashairXichangjing ophiolite, located at the middle section of the Beishan area,is one of the well exposed ophiolitic belts in the Beishan area. The pillow basalt and cumulate gabbro are characterized by depletion of LREE, flat distribution pattern, and(La/Yb)N = 0. 47-- 1. 62, similar to those of N-MORB; and by enrichment of LILEs, and depletion of HFSEs such as Nb and Ta, different from those of N-MORB, but similar to those by typical island-arc volcanic rocks, I. e. the mafic rocks have both the MORB-like and arc-like geochemical features. These features are similar to those of mafic rocks occurring in the Kuerti ophiolite which formed in the back-arc basin. Their geochemical features reflect a tectonic setting of back arc basin in which volcanic rock formed. The End(t) of other samples are positive and high (6. 11 --8. 17),which implies that the source area is the depleted mantle. Combined with the geochemical and sedimentary characteristics, it can be concluded that the Yueyashan-Xichangjing ophiolite may form in a back-arc basin, which, along with Xieshan-Dongqiyi volcanic arc in the north of the basin, constituted an "arc-basin" system in the Tarim plate.
